Bike rack for class B

I have a Yakima TwoTimer for 2 bikes and would like advice on whether that is safe for a Class B Winnebago Era. I have read that some bike racks cannot endure the bouncing of the rear of a motorhome. Any experiences to share?

I have a Saris 2 place rack that is very similar to yours, I use it on the back and occasionally on the front of my Class C.

Mine uses a bolt instead of a hitch pin to really make it tight in the receiver so it doesn't rattle around or move back and forth in the receiver.

I also use one of these to make sure it's good and tight. This thing removes all play in the receiver.

I use the same type of hitch tightener on my class A.
It works great, makes the bike rack VERY solid on the back of the RV.
